Precision Cuts: Miter Saw Techniques for Aluminium Sections
Achieving clean cuts in aluminium sections using a miter tool demands specialized approaches . Unlike wood , aluminium tends to warp during cutting , making conventional practices ineffective . Therefore, utilizing techniques like slow feed speeds , lubricant application, and scoring can significantly boost the result of the slice . Furthermore, selecting the correct cutting disc – typically a fine-tooth aluminum slicing blade – is crucial . Consider also supporting the profile to minimize vibration and secure a square cut .
- Lower feed pace.
- Apply fluid.
- Kerf the section.

Maximizing Efficiency: Aluminium Sawing with Miter Saws
To achieve optimal output when cutting alloy with a sliding saw, thorough preparation is essential. Begin by using a saw made specifically for soft alloys, verifying a fine blade spacing to reduce burr and build-up. Then, lower the machine's speed – a reduced feed rate avoids binding and delivers a smoother slice. Finally, keep to use fluid to additionaly diminish heat and prolong blade life.
